1.1. Lifeline Program Overview

The Lifeline program is a federally supported benefit that helps low-income households lower the cost of phone or internet service. The program is overseen by the FCC and limits support to one Lifeline benefit per household. Lifeline does not provide cash and does not guarantee devices. Instead, it reduces your monthly service bill, while approved providers may add phone or tablet offers based on stock, ZIP code, and promotions.

Monthly Lifeline service discount:

  • About $9.25 per month for standard households
  • Up to $34.25 per month for eligible Tribal lands

When you qualify, the discount is applied directly to your phone or internet plan through an approved Lifeline provider.

1.2. Two Ways to Qualify for Lifeline

You can get AirTalk Wireless free phone and tablet offers when qualifying for Lifeline by one of two ways: program-based or income-based eligibility.

Program-based eligibility

  • SNAP / EBT
  • Medicaid
  • SSI
  • Public Housing or Section 8
  • Veterans benefits

Is the government giving away free Galaxy phones?

No. The government does not give away phones directly. The federal Lifeline program provides a monthly service discount, and approved providers may offer free Galaxy phones as part of their plans.
